Fake note circulation case : Man gets 4 years jail

Mangaluru, Feb 18, 2023: The Third District and Sessions Court of Mangaluru has sentenced a man to four years of imprisonment in a case pertaining to circulation of fake currency notes.

The convict is Abbas (53) of Ira village in Bantwal taluk. He was arrested in 2019 while he was trying to circulate fake notes in Mulki area. Police had then seized 16 fake currency notes of Rs 100 denomination from him.

It was stated that  Abbas had got 20 colour xerox prints of 3 real currency notes of Rs 100 denomination  at a xerox shop  on Falnir Road in the city on October 24, 2019. The same year in November he had given the  fake note to a shop in  Mulki after making some purchases. Similarly he circulated the fake note at an eatery and four other places.

A few who suspected that the notes were fake had informed the police following which an investigation was launched.
